
"The Regime" Finale: Unraveling Kate Winslet's Reign
Will Tracy, creator of The Regime, initially wrote the lead character as a man but changed it to a woman, played by Kate Winslet, leading to an unpredictable and victorious ending in the series finale. Tracy explains that his obsession with reading about authoritarian governments inspired the show, and he chose a fictional setting to avoid evoking any real person or country. Despite real-world events mirroring the show, Tracy feels the series has reached its natural conclusion with six episodes but doesn't rule out the possibility of more in the future.
